Arrival at Medjugorje: The Heart of the Tour
Once you arrive in Medjugorje, you’ll head straight to the famous Apparition Hill (Podbrdo). This hillside is where the Virgin Mary is said to have appeared to visionaries starting in 1981. People often describe this as a peaceful and powerful spot—perfect for prayer and reflection. Many pilgrims choose to climb to the top, which offers panoramic views and a chance for quiet contemplation. Several reviews mention that the climb is doable, but comfortable shoes are a must.
Next, the group visits St. James Church—the spiritual hub of the community. You might find that attending a mass or just soaking in the tranquil atmosphere adds to the experience. The church’s architecture and serenity often leave visitors with a sense of calm, regardless of their faith background.
